CI-4/E7 is a diesel engine additive package that meets specifications for API CI-4 and ACEA E7 performance categories. These performance categories are developed by industry organizations to ensure that diesel engine oils and additives meet specific requirements for performance, durability and emissions control.
API CI-4 is a performance category for heavy-duty diesel engine oils. It is designed to meet the needs of modern low-emission diesel engines. CI-4 oils provide enhanced wear protection, improved oxidation control, and better soot and sludge control compared to previous API performance categories.
ACEA E7 is a performance category established by the European Automobile Manufacturers Association (ACEA). It specifies the requirements for lubricants used in high-speed four-stroke diesel engines, including engines equipped with exhaust gas recirculation (EGR) and/or diesel particulate filters (DPF). E7 oil provides excellent engine cleanliness, wear protection and deposit control.

CI-4/E7 Diesel Additive Complexes are formulated to meet the combined requirements of API CI-4 and ACEA E7 performance categories. They often contain a carefully balanced mix of additives such as detergents, dispersants, antiwear agents, antioxidants and viscosity modifiers. These additives work together to enhance engine protection, improve fuel efficiency and reduce emissions.
